PORT ST. LUCIE, Fla. — Professional soccer is headed to Port St. Lucie!
During a Monday morning news conference, city officials were joined by representatives of the United Soccer League to announce that the Port St. Lucie Sports Club was awarded a USL franchise.
In addition, officials announced that a new 6,000-seat stadium will be built at the Walton & One development, a 46-acre mixed-use redevelopment project located along U.S. 1.
The United Soccer League said it will launch professional men's and women's soccer teams.
